The tariff classification of konjac powder from Indonesia

Ruling Text

N312676 July 16, 2020 CLA-2-11:OT:RR:NC:N2:228 CATEGORY: Classification TARIFF NO.: 1106.20.9000 Mr. Andy Palencia Kanematsu USA Inc. 543 W. Algonquin Rd. Arlington Heights, IL 60005 RE: The tariff classification of konjac powder from Indonesia Dear Mr. Palencia: In your letter dated June 22, 2020, you requested a tariff classification ruling. An ingredients breakdown, a narrative description of the manufacturing process and a manufacturing flowchart were submitted with your letter for the product. Konjac powder is said to contain 100 percent konjac, which naturally contains glucomannan. Its principle use is as a gelatin substitute to thicken or add texture to foods. The product will be imported in paper bags, 25 kg., net packed. The applicable subheading for the product will be 1106.20.9000,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TSUS), which provides for flour, meal and powder of the dried leguminous vegetables of heading 0713, of sago or of roots or tubers of heading 0714 or of the products of chapter 8: of sago or of roots or tubers of heading 0714: other. The general rate of duty is free. Duty rates are provided for your convenience and are subject to change. This merchandise is subject to The Public Health Security and Bioterrorism Preparedness and Response Act of 2002 (The Bioterrorism Act), which is regulated by the Food and Drug Administration (FDA). Information on the Bioterrorism Act can be obtained by calling FDA at 301-575-0156, or at the Web site www.fda.gov/oc/bioterrorism/bioact.html. This ruling is being issued under the provisions of Part 177 of the Customs Regulations (19 C.F.R. 177). A copy of the ruling or the control number indicated above should be provided with the entry documents filed at the time this merchandise is imported.
